Generally, it is safe to put a cake in the freezer to cool, but there are some important things to keep in mind to ensure your cake turns out just right. Yes, you can put your cake in the fridge to cool, provided you let the cake cool briefly (about 5 to 10 minutes) on the countertop first. Yes, you can cool a cake in the fridge after letting it cool slightly in the pan for about 5 to 10 minutes. This helps the cake set and makes it easier to handle.
